Transaction 05c60184143482f89b074993334840dd540b90760bdf1ea8763b90d2a13723af
4 Input
2 Outputs
- 05c60184143482f89b074993334840dd540b90760bdf1ea8763b90d2a13723af:0
- 05c60184143482f89b074993334840dd540b90760bdf1ea8763b90d2a13723af:1
value 7336758
address 1AEsE6nDtkuHUMhTJ9nc5X182ojScUqGDo
value 936775
address 1B5gZuCPsqdx2f63zsstYAq1TKC6nBcgdu